プラットフォーム:win10,64ビットpycharm、のpython3、AccessDatabaseEngine_X64、pywin32-221.win- AMD64-py3.7。
ヒント:64ビットシステムの整合性64を維持する必要があります。コードは、直接、理解しやすい、プロテストを実行することができる、システムがODBC64ビット・データ・ソースを提供する必要がなく、ラフな工程を示しています。
リソース:リンクします。https://pan.baidu.com/s/1TxT5bng3P2FUYW5nojA6uQ
抽出コード:uwd3。
win32com.clientインポート
#負荷駆動装置は、パス自体修正
コネチカット= win32com.client.gencache.EnsureDispatch( 'ADODB.Connectionの')
/試験/ hbzh2005:D = SOURCE DATA; DSN =「PROVIDER = Microsoft.ACE.OLEDB.12.0を。 MDB; '
conn.Open(DSN)
RS = win32com.client.Dispatch(r'ADODB.Recordset')
#アクセスローカル・データベース・テーブル、データの516行の合計
rs_name = "リザーバ"
rs.Open( '[' + rs_name + ']'、コネチカット,. 1 ,. 3)
rs.MoveFirst()
COUNT = 0
一方TRUE:
:RS.EOF IF
BREAK
他の:
。COUNT = COUNTの+ 1
rs.MoveNext()
はconn.close()
プリント(COUNT)